What contribution did women make to the war effort during WWII?

Answer: A Majority of women worked in the factories producing the items needed to fight the war from bombers to field kitchens in the Allied Powers. As well as serving as cooks and nurses in the armed forces, but where not allowed to fight. In the Axis Powers, women where kept at home and where expected to run the house hold. Leaving the men to run the factories, draining valuable manpower. Women in the Soviet Union saw limited action as snipers and where very effective.
